Bishop Grimes asked the Sisters of Mercy to set up a community in Ross to provide a Catholic education for the children who lived in the area. A house was bought on the corner of Bond Street and Park terrace, and made into a convent. A school was opened in the Sisters Convent in 1889. In 1909 a new school was built beside the convent. The school was closed in 1962.
